Output 8985afb2c58a7a9ea801456a6917898e2e74142b8f5eb053aa8bbf206f334a1d:153

value
44377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da78d7ecf086596999618c1f584cb1b704381deb OP_EQUAL
address
3McBziLZ5fQ7rZsSuwcRMLkucCrEF2ipnG
transaction
8985afb2c58a7a9ea801456a6917898e2e74142b8f5eb053aa8bbf206f334a1d
spent
true